Hamiltonian stationary Lagrangian tori in Kähler manifolds
AbstractA Hamiltonian stationary Lagrangian submanifold of a Kähler manifold is a Lagrangian submanifold whose volume is stationary under Hamiltonian variations. We find a sufficient condition on the curvature of a Kähler manifold of real dimension four to guar- antee the existence of a family of small Hamiltonian stationary Lagrangian tori.
